Title 13 : Crimes and Criminal Procedure

Chapter 081 : Trespass and Malicious Injuries to Property

Subchapter 002 : Injuries to Other Property

(Cite as: 13 V.S.A. § 3738)
  • § 3738. Obstruction and use of private roads and lands by motor vehicle

    A person who, by use of a motor vehicle as defined in 23 V.S.A. § 4:

    (1) obstructs a private driveway, barway, or gateway; or

    (2) travels over a private road that is so marked, or travels over other private lands; or

    (3) enters on private lands for the purpose of camping; without the permission of the owner or occupant shall be fined not more than $500.00. (Added 1967, No. 173; amended 1971, No. 95, § 1, eff. April 22, 1971.)
